Understanding the Role of a Car Key Replacement Locksmith
A car key replacement locksmith concentrates on the duplication, reprogramming, and replacement of vehicle keys and locks. These technicians have the know-how to deal with both traditional keys and advanced keyless entry systems.
Services Offered by Car Key Replacement Locksmiths:Key Duplication: Creating a duplicate key from an original.Key Replacement: Replacing a lost or stolen key.Key Fob Programming: Reprogramming or replacing electronic key fobs.Ignition Repair and Replacement: Addressing problems with the ignition system.Lockout Services: Assisting chauffeurs who are locked out of their automobiles.Transponder Key Services: Programming and cutting transponder keys for modern-day cars.Types of Car Keys
Comprehending the different types of car keys can reduce the procedure of replacement and the services you might require from a locksmith.
1. Conventional Metal KeysDescription: Basic keys used in older vehicle designs.Replacement Process: Simple cutting of a new key based on the initial.2. Transponder KeysDescription: Keys geared up with a radio frequency identification chip configured to interact with the car's ignition.Replacement Process: Involves cutting the key and programming the chip to match the vehicle's system.3. Key FobsDescription: Electronic gadgets that enable remote access and ignition.Replacement Process: Typically requires programming by a locksmith or dealer after cutting the physical key.4. Smart KeysDescription: Keyless entry systems that permit starting the car without inserting a key.Replacement Process: Often includes a complex reprogramming procedure due to their innovative technology.Table: Comparison of Key TypesKey TypeDescriptionReplacement ComplexityAverage Cost RangeStandard MetalBasic key for older modelsLow₤ 2 - ₤ 10TransponderKey with a chip for modern ignitionsMedium₤ 50 - ₤ 200Key FobRemote access electronic keyHigh₤ 50 - ₤ 300Smart KeyKeyless entry systemVery High₤ 200 - ₤ 500The Replacement Process
Identify the Key Type: Determine if you are handling a traditional key, transponder, key fob, or smart key.
Contact a Professional: Reach out to a reliable car key replacement locksmith. It's necessary to discover a competent technician that concentrates on your vehicle's make and design.
Offer Vehicle Information: Be prepared to offer needed details including the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number), make, model, and year.
Assessment and Assessment: The locksmith will examine your scenario, which may include analyzing the lock, ignition system, and existing keys.
Replacement or Reprogramming: Depending on the key type, the locksmith will either cut a new key, program a brand-new transponder key, or established a replacement key fob.
Evaluating: After replacement, the locksmith will evaluate the new key to guarantee it works properly with your vehicle's locks and ignition.
Secure Your Keys: It's suggested to make duplicates of brand-new keys, specifically for key fobs and transponders, and secure them in a safe location.

For how long does it take to replace a car key?
The replacement time can differ from 20 minutes to over an hour, depending upon the key type and intricacy.
2. Are car key replacements covered by insurance coverage?
Lots of insurance coverage might cover key replacements, specifically if a key is lost or stolen. It's recommended to examine your policy information.
3.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?
Yes, lots of locksmiths can develop a new key based upon the lock or ignition system using their specialized tools.
4. How can I avoid losing my car type in the future?
Developing a regular for where you save your keys, utilizing key tracking devices, and getting an extra key can help prevent future losses.
5. Why would my car key suddenly quit working?
There could be numerous reasons, including battery concerns in key fobs, harmed transponder chips, or issues with the ignition cylinder.
